How to Make Crack Chicken Pinwheels

Step 1: Prepare the filling

In a mixing bowl, combine shredded chicken, softened cream cheese, cheddar cheese, crispy bacon bits, chopped green onions, garlic powder, and paprika. Mix thoroughly until everything is evenly incorporated into a creamy, flavorful filling.

Step 2: Spread the filling on tortillas

Lay out your tortilla wraps flat on a clean surface. Spread a generous layer of the chicken and cheese mixture over each tortilla, ensuring an even coat all the way to the edges for maximum flavor in every bite.

Step 3: Roll and chill

Roll each filled tortilla tightly into a log shape. Wrap the logs in cling film or parchment paper and place them in the refrigerator to chill for at least 30 minutes. This step helps them hold their shape when slicing.

Step 4: Slice into pinwheels

Once chilled, carefully slice each roll into 1-inch thick pinwheels using a sharp knife. Arrange them neatly on a serving platter or baking tray if you plan to warm them up.

Step 5: Optional bake or serve cold

If you prefer warm pinwheels, bake them in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 10-12 minutes or until the cheese melts and the edges turn slightly golden. They’re equally delicious served cold as a quick snack or party appetizer.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Place any leftover Crack Chicken Pinwheels in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days to keep them fresh and tasty. They maintain their flavor well when chilled.

Freezing

For longer storage, freeze assembled pinwheel logs before slicing. Wrap each tightly in plastic wrap and then foil, and fre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ator before slicing and serving.

Reheating

Reheat frozen or refrigerated pinwheels in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 8-10 minutes until warmed through without drying out. You can also microwave them briefly, but the oven method keeps them crispier.

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ients

  • 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up crispy bacon bits
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ions
  • 4 large tortilla wraps
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p paprika

Instructions

  1. Prepare the filling: In a m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ar cheese, crispy bacon bits, chopped green onions, garlic powder, and paprika. Mix thoroughly until everything is well incorporated into a creamy, flavorful filling.
  2. Spread the filling on tortillas: Lay out the tortilla wraps flat on a clean surface. Spread a generous, even layer of the chicken and cheese mixture over each tortilla, covering all the way to the edges for maximum flavor.
  3. Roll and chill: Roll each filled tortilla tightly into a log shape. Wrap the logs in cling film or parchment paper and place them in the refrigerator to chill for at least 30 minutes. This helps them hold their shape for slicing.
  4. Slice into pinwheels: Once chilled, carefully slice each roll into 1-inch thick pinwheels using a sharp knife. Arrange them neatly on a serving platter or baking tray if you intend to warm them up.
  5. Optional bake or serve cold: To serve warm pinwheels, bake them in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 10-12 minutes until the cheese melts and edges turn slightly golden. They are equally delicious served cold as snacks or appetizers.
